blazor input date default value

The Blazor framework provides built-in input components to receive and validate user input. Classes for managing form elements, state, and validation. The custom CSS class rendered on the wrapping element.

I can't repro this. All Rights Reserved. Thanks for contributing an answer to Stack Overflow!

professional grade UI library with 100+ native components for building modern and feature-rich applications.

Changing the EditContext after it's assigned is not supported. In Blazor components <input @bind-value = "MyTime" > and <input @bind-value = "MyDate"> complaint MyTyme and MyDate must be DateTime if they are respectively TimeOnly and DateOnly types.

See the ShowWeekNumbers parameter below. Types that can accept null values also support nullability of the target field (for example, int?

Place the inputs corresponding to its fields in an EditForm.

For more information, see Model validation in ASP.NET Core MVC. It can be changed using the. The Date Input enables users to change the value by pressing the arrow keys. Blazor is not to blame here, it's a .net thing. How to change the value of KeyPairValue in dictionary? How to pass a URL input parameter value to Blazor page? Copyright 2023 www.appsloveworld.com. The handler's result updates the ValidationMessageStore instance.

nativescript The event object can have unique event.detail parameters. How to convert date value to oracle date value?

For guidance on adding packages to .NET apps, see the articles under Install and manage packages at Package consumption workflow (NuGet documentation). InputDate and InputNumber support error message templates: In the Starfleet Starship Database form (FormExample2 component) of the Example form section with a friendly display name assigned, the Production Date field produces an error message using the following default error message template: The position of the {0} placeholder is where the value of the DisplayName property appears when the error is displayed to the user. Playing a sound when the object gets through a specific rotation, Quick Question: Whats wrong with this pre-processor directive in C#, Handling transaction context using method attribute in linq to sql, Threadsafe usage of PKCS11Interop library in C#. Not the answer you're looking for? As an alternative to the use of a validation component, data annotation validation attributes can be used.

The following parameters enable you to customize the appearance of the Blazor Date Picker: You can find more options for customizing the Date Picker styling in the Appearance article. rxjs The value of each radio button is fixed, but the value of the radio button group is the value of the selected radio button. Use of a validator component is recommended where an independent model class is used across several components. ionic-framework bootstrap-4 For example, InputDate and InputNumber handle unparseable values gracefully by registering unparseable values as validation errors. For information on how empty strings and null values are handled in data binding, see ASP.NET Core Blazor data binding.

How to set Default value as null for InputDate field in Blazor?

The response contains more data than just the validation errors, as shown in the following example when all of the fields of the Starfleet Starship Database form aren't submitted and the form fails validation: To demonstrate the preceding JSON response, you must either disable the form's client-side validation to permit empty field form submission or use a tool to send a request directly to the server API, such as Firefox Browser Developer or Postman. , Since in blazor @bind-Value and @onchange cannot co exists as at now here is the best work around, both Prevent default actions for events and Stop event propagation are supported in Blazor apps since .NET Core 3.1 Preview 2 check thisd link Add an additional property to ExampleModel, for example: Add the Description to the ExampleForm7 component's form: Update the EditContext instance in the component's OnInitialized method to use the new Field CSS Class Provider: Because a CSS validation class isn't applied to the Description field (id="description"), it isn't styled.

rating

One such way is to change something else on the element, like a @key which will force Blazor to replace the entire element. There is a InputDate component, so I can enter date, but there is no nice and convenient way to enter time and date in the same field (or in separate fields) added the area-blazor label on Jan 1, 2020 jaymcguinness commented on Jan 2, 2020 edited InputDate builds a HTML compliant Input element with the type attribute set to "date" Don't use both for the same form. Add or update the namespace to match the namespace of the shared app (for example, namespace BlazorSample.Shared).

The consent submitted will only be used for data processing originating from this website. Automatic correction of invalid date segments. vue.js Optionally, provide custom Format, Min and Max values, Basic Date Picker with custom format, min and max. Watch the Announcements GitHub repository, the dotnet/aspnetcore GitHub repository, or this topic section for further updates. Why did OpenSSH create its own key format, and not use PKCS#8? nestjs reactjs If the user input does not match the desired pattern, the value is not accepted. You can set the increment and decrement steps through the nested DatePickerSteps tag and its parameters. How can citizens assist at an aircraft crash site?

twitter-bootstrap mysql nativescript-angular Progress, Telerik, and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. Double-sided tape maybe? Handle these events to react to user actions and customize the component behavior.

Can state or city police officers enforce the FCC regulations? In algorithms for matrix multiplication (eg Strassen), why do we say n is equal to the number of rows and not the number of elements in both matrices? Setting it to DateTimePickerDropDownDisplayMode.TimePicker will create a time-only picker display. jestjs

How to save a selection of features, temporary in QGIS? syntax-highlighting Download Free Trial.

An example of data being processed may be a unique identifier stored in a cookie. image-processing We and our partners use cookies to Store and/or access information on a device. for a nullable integer). Defaults to, Navigates to a specified date and view. Smart.DateTimePicker allows users to easily select Date, Time or DateTime value. The Blazor Date Picker provides various parameters that allow you to configure the component: The date picker is, essentially, a date input and a calendar and the properties it exposes are mapped to the corresponding properties of these two components. To learn more, see our tips on writing great answers.

To try it out sign up for a free 30-day trial.

Read more at, The component value.

Use of a validator component is recommended where an independent model class is used across several components. The @onchange event provides an array of the selected options via event arguments (ChangeEventArgs). Are there developed countries where elected officials can easily terminate government workers? Update the namespace to match the app (for example, namespace BlazorSample.Client). So far you don't run an Task method. Use them to change the component appearance declaratively and without custom CSS. Logging is executed depending on the validation result.

In the following FormExample6 component, update the namespace of the Shared project (@using BlazorSample.Shared) to the shared project's namespace. Use the TelerikDatePicker tag to add the component to your razor page. Add the Microsoft.AspNetCore.Mvc namespace to the top of the Startup.cs file in the Server app: In Startup.ConfigureServices, locate the AddControllersWithViews extension method and add the following call to ConfigureApiBehaviorOptions: The Microsoft.AspNetCore.Components.DataAnnotations.Validation package has a latest version of release candidate at NuGet.org. templating When I run my code, by default its set to 01/01/0001. In the following example, valid (validField) and invalid (invalidField) styles are specified. The page contains datePicker but without any value. The Date Picker enables the end users to change the selected value by clicking the rendered arrows. When assigning to Model, confirm that the model type is instantiated, as the following example shows: To demonstrate how an EditForm component works with data annotations validation, consider the following ExampleModel type. How can I set the default value for an HTML